- All Courses
- PHP
Best PHP Courses
These free online PHP courses will help get you working with PHP before you know it. PHP is an established industry standard programming language used for a variety of powerful server side applications and is an essential skill for any full-stack developer. If you're learning to program or just picking up a new language, this page is a great place to start....âŠRead More
- 10 Free Courses
- 77,135 Learners
- 4,991 Certificates & Diplomas Earned
Most Popular
PHP Courses

Diploma in DevOps Engineering - Kubernetes, Docker and Google Cloud
- Discuss the fundamental concepts and terminology of Micr...
- Summarize the functions of Kubernetes, Docker and Google...
- Create a Google Cloud account and discuss dif... Read More

Diploma in Application Development Using PHP and MySQL
- Create a PHP coding environment on Windows, Mac, and Lin...
- Apply codes using the echo command in PHP
- Recognize the various ways to do comments in ... Read More

Introduction to PHP
- Identify the various data types in PHP
- Recognise how to write basic PHP programs
- Explain how to create arrays and use decision-making sta...
- Describe how to write loops and use the break... Read More

Diploma in E-Commerce Web Development
- Demonstrate how to create an e-commerce website from scr...
- Display featured products correctly on a web page using ...
- Break down how âproduct detail modalsâ are pr... Read More

Laravel Advanced Topics
- Explain what the service container is and its role in La...
- Define what facades are in Laravel and their purpose in ...
- Describe how to bind services and objects into the conta...
- Create one-to-one, one-to-many and many-to-ma... Read More

A Beginner's Guide to MySQLi
- Explain MySQLi's features, applications and system requi...
- Outline the steps involved in connecting to a database u...
- Recognise the procedure for creating a database
- Indicate the ways to pull single and multiple... Read More

Easy approach to installing NGINX, PHP, MySQL, SSL & WordPress on Ubuntu
- Distinguish between Apache and NGINX
- Outline the features and benefits of NGINX
- Explain the process of deploying a virtual se... Read More

Beginner in Multiple Domain Hosting on One Virtual Server
- Discuss how to create and attach floating IPs to Digital...
- Recall how to create the directory structure for hosting...
- Outline the installation process for MySQL an... Read More

Design, Deliver, and Administer Web Applications using LAMP
- Create and deploy a highly available LAMP Stack
- List more servers or resources without causing users to ...
- Arrange a local test environment such as Virt... Read More

Password-Less Authentication Guide Using Facebook Account Kit
- Describe how to install and configure the XAMPP local se...
- Identify basic HTML elements and attributes
- Recall how to apply some basic CSS selectors ... Read More
Benefits Of An Alison Certificate
Certify Your Skills
A CPD accredited Alison Certificate certifies the skills youâve learnedStand Out From The Crowd
Add your Alison Certification to your resumé and stay ahead of the competitionAdvance in Your Career
Share your Alison Certification with potential employers to show off your skills and capabilities

Explore Courses By Category
Explore In-Demand Careers
Discover More CareersPopular Course Creators
Over 45 million learners have used Alison to empower themselves
Not sure where to begin?
What is your main goal on Alison?
- 4,500+ free courses
- 45 million+ learners
- 10 million+ graduates
- 195 countries